Disney’s Fort Wilderness Resort & Campground, guests often have a little flexibility to move the picnic tables around their campsite to suit their needs. Moving the table under your canopy for better shade and convenience is usually okay, as long as it stays within your designated campsite area and doesn’t block any pathways. However, it's always a good idea to double-check with the Fort Wilderness Cast Members when you check in. They can confirm any specific guidelines and ensure you’re all set for a magical stay!
If you'd rather be safe than sorry, bringing your own foldable table can also be a great solution. It gives you extra space and flexibility without any concerns about the rules.
I’m looking forward to a stay at Fort Wilderness with my family next spring, and here’s what’s on my “must-do” list:
Hoop-Dee-Doo Musical Revue - This classic dinner show is an all-you-can-eat feast with fried chicken, BBQ ribs, and more while being entertained by lively singing, dancing, and comedy. It's a rootin', tootin' good time for the whole family!
Chip ‘n’ Dale’s Campfire Sing-A-Long - Everyone’s favorite chipmunks host an evening of s’mores, songs, and a classic Disney movie under the stars. It’s a great way to unwind after a day at the parks. Also, any time there are s’mores involved, count me in!
